The U. S. Energy Information Administration surveys households to obtain data on residential energy consumption and expenditures and find out the mean residential energy expenditure of all U. S. families in 1995 was $1,123. That same year, 15 randomly selected upper-income families reported their energy expenditures. Their mean energy expenditures was $1,344.27 and the standard deviation was $231.
At the 5% significance level, do the data indicate that in 1995, upper-income families spent more on the average, for energy than the national average of $1,123?
